This is the correct java you need.
Now! Go to,
START/Set Program Access/Change or Remove Programs,
now completely remove all versions of java.
Re BOOT Your computer NOW.

Now! Use this Blue Link to get "Java Runtime Environment (JRE) 5.0 Update 12" Use the off line installer, NOT the (recommended) one, 4th one down.
Java SE Downloads - Previous Release - JDK 5
When Download is completed.
Disconnect from internet, close ALL apps n reinstall java.

Try switching to Manual Port forward using port numbers between 45000 To 65000
Both Manual Port forward No, & listening port should be set at the same number
In LimeWire, GO to Tools/Options/Advanced/Firewall Config & use Manual Port forward.

Your router is an infamous one. It has firmware problems which Linksys never bothered to fix. Port forwarding is one fix, though it still may have some unreliable issues. The other is to fix the firmware yourself. There is a post on the forum about how to do that.

Well with such firewall issues, and you don't care about uploading? Well you will never be an ultrapeer, never be able to direct connect, and having less connections due to no uploads will mean less search & download results. It does make a difference.
